Storing stations
In the example, the station "big FM" is
selected and you would like to store this as
preset position 1 in the station presets.
You can save your four favourite stations to
the first four preset positions in this way.
X
Press and hold preset position 1 until you
hear a confirmation tone.
:
The current station is stored as preset
position 1

Entering characters in navigation
Entering characters
The following sections explain character
entry for the example of entering the street
name Unter den Linden.
X
Call up the "Entering a street name" menu
(Y page 29).
All letters are available in the menu.
X
Enter U, N, T.
The letters are entered in the entry
line :.
